**02:41 UTC** — The Nightjar backfill scheduler wedged itself again. It grabbed the lock for the daily partition sweep, then crashed before releasing it, so every subsequent backfill queued up behind a ghost. If you're on call and see the queue depth alarm from Hollowpine, don't restart the workers first — clear the stale lock via the admin console, then restart. Tomas added a lock TTL in tonight's patch so this shouldn't recur. The fix shipped under the build referenced below.

pipeline stamp: htk9_ce63042d9

Handover Note — Ferncastle Media
From: J. Maddox, outgoing Director
To: E. Strand, incoming Director
Cc: Finance Team

Marketing budget cut of 15% is approved and effective next quarter. Agency retainers with Opaline Works already renegotiated; the Drimmond campaign is cancelled, penalties settled. Outstanding accruals need clearing this month. Strand assumes sign-off authority immediately. Context on the strategic reasoning sits in the confidential note below.

management briefing: The renewal with Quenathox Group closes at $10 million a year, 20 percent below the last contract. Project Ulawyn slips by two quarters because of the supplier delay.

Changed defaults: dependency pinning is now strict by default. Previously, the resolver accepted floating minor versions unless a project opted into lockfiles; this caused two release rollbacks last quarter when transitive packages shifted under us. From 4.2 onward, every build resolves against the committed lockfile, and unpinned declarations fail CI. Release managers should note that override windows still exist for hotfixes but now expire automatically. The new default resolver settings are as follows.

settings of fafog-haduf:
ZORIX_PIN=4648
ZORIX_METRICS_HOST=metrics.zorix.paliqsys.corp
ZORIX_LOG_LEVEL=info
ZORIX_TENANT=druix

Ticket DL-412: Expired creds on Proselint-Nine

For weekly sync: the docs linter (Proselint-Nine) stopped gating merges Tuesday. Root cause: its credential for the Harkwell style-registry expired silently. No alerting on token expiry — adding that as follow-up. Temporary fix applied on the runner; permanent rotation scheduled. Until automation lands, the runner authenticates with the replacement key below.

app token of bahof-tahop = kto23_W3GnSQ3WTTCkTZ8q4JWHIKi